Function TP_1G_DELETE_PNR pattern details

In-order to call this FM within your sap programs, simply using the below ABAP pattern details to trigger the function call...or see the full ABAP code listing at the end of this article. You can simply cut and paste this code into your ABAP progrom as it is, including variable declarations.
CALL FUNCTION 'TP_1G_DELETE_PNR'"
EXPORTING
CONTEXT_NUMBER = "Context
REC_LOC = "Passenger Name Record Locator

EXCEPTIONS
NO_DESTINATION = 1 INVALID_CONTEXT = 2 CONNECTION_ERROR = 3 RFC_ERROR = 4 GENERAL_API_ERROR = 5 NO_SEGMENTS_TO_CANCEL = 6
.



IMPORTING Parameters details for TP_1G_DELETE_PNR

CONTEXT_NUMBER - Context

Data type: FTPT_VARIANT-VARIANT
Optional: No
Call by Reference: No ( called with pass by value option)

REC_LOC - Passenger Name Record Locator

Data type: FTPT_VARIANT-REC_LOCATOR
Optional: No
Call by Reference: No ( called with pass by value option)
